This is a pretty good track. Don't know the original. Having said that, I would tone down the chord stabs that play when the vocal chops do, to give a sense of hierarchy between them. These sounds compete with each other right now.

I would also revise the arrangement. Perhaps add another moment -  a climax would be ideal. 3 -mostly- identical buildups and drops is a bit much. I know you added a couple extra hats here and there but to me that isn't quite enough to make the track truly explode. I can see an epic synth line or a moombahton dembow adding a lot to that final minute.

Either that or cut the track to 2:30, which isn't unheard of on radio edits.

Are you looking for advice in a specific area? Since you said this was mostly done, I am assuming you aren't changing much of the track...

Right off the bat, i have two arrangement suggestions - the intro could be a little gentler, no need to rush things, especially when using two or three melodic phrases at once. Also the outro is a little abrupt, especially with all of the drama and big sounds used across the entire track.

While the plucked instrument and sax play each other off well, they could use a little more contrast. Perhaps a little EQ ing to the string would make the sax come alive.

The beat is pretty solid! I would say that although you want the focus to be on the lead, you should still have some minor background notes to complement the lead; otherwise, it could end up sounding empty.
Thanks :) - Yes, hence the flute. Will add.

not sure if youre working on the mix or not yet but theres very little atmosphere to these instruments. A bit of reverb and stereo placement could really open up this track and give it its own "space." I like the organic sounds and think a flute would sound really nice in there just as long as the melodies arent overlapping to much. Maybe make the flute counter the existing melodies so they play off each other
Yes, I definitely agree with the lack of atmosphere. I guess I overdid the narrowing the instruments's stereo placing. My kick and snare weren't really popping out. Then I ducked the whole thing using them. Guess I can open up the instruments and really crank up the reverb/ stereo imaging.
